North Fambridge station keeps things simple. While there isn't a ticket office, the station is equipped with ticket machines where you can purchase and collect tickets for your journey. Accessibility is a consideration here; accessible ticket machines and an induction loop are in place to assist hearing-impaired travelers, even though the station doesn’t have step-free access to all areas. If you're looking for a place to sit while waiting for your train, seating is available, although there are no waiting rooms or first-class lounges.
Parking is straightforward with a 24-hour car park operated by National Car Parks Ltd, offering 138 spaces, including one accessible space. You'll find competitive pricing with daily rates at £4.70 and discounts for longer-term permits. Bicyclists can park their bikes at one of the 16 bicycle stands available in the car park, which is, although secure, not sheltered. However, the station lacks bodies like ATMs, shops, or refreshments facilities; a friendly reminder to plan ahead for your journey.
Although North Fambridge might not have a bustling array of transport links, there is a rail replacement service located on Fambridge Road at the junction with Station Approach, providing an alternative route when needed. Southbourne Station provides travelers with a range of essential services, from straightforward ticket buying options to crucial assistance facilities. The ticket office operates from 06:35 to 13:10 on weekdays and Saturdays, with convenient ticket machines available for purchases outside these hours. These machines support transactions with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, but visitors should check the station map for step-free access details to avoid any inconvenience.
While there are no ticket barriers, the station ensures safety with comprehensive CCTV coverage. Although there’s no dedicated waiting room, seating areas provide some comfort as you await your train. It’s worth noting that Southbourne Station does not have public Wi-Fi, toilets, or refreshment facilities, so planning ahead for these needs might be necessary.
Accessibility is a key focus at Southbourne, with step-free access facilitated by ramps and platforms reachable via a level crossing. Assistance is readily available, with helpful staff on hand during ticket office hours and help points located strategically on the platforms. For those requiring extra help, assistance can also be arranged by contacting the Southern Railway's Assisted Travel Service. Be advised, arriving 20 minutes before your train is recommended to ensure all arrangements are seamless.
The station’s onward travel support enhances its appeal, offering connections through local buses and a rail replacement service when necessary. Though no bicycles are stored at the station, there is a local parish council cycle rack for the adventurous traveler.
